Solution for 4u^2+4=-17u equation:


Simplifying
4u2 + 4 = -17u

Reorder the terms:
4 + 4u2 = -17u

Solving
4 + 4u2 = -17u

Solving for variable 'u'.

Reorder the terms:
4 + 17u + 4u2 = -17u + 17u

Combine like terms: -17u + 17u = 0
4 + 17u + 4u2 = 0

Factor a trinomial.
(4 + u)(1 + 4u)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(4 + u)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 4 + u = 0 Solving 4 + u = 0 Move all terms containing u to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-4' to each side of the equation. 4 + -4 + u = 0 + -4 Combine like terms: 4 + -4 = 0 0 + u = 0 + -4 u = 0 + -4 Combine like terms: 0 + -4 = -4 u = -4 Simplifying u = -4

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(1 + 4u)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 1 + 4u = 0 Solving 1 + 4u = 0 Move all terms containing u to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-1' to each side of the equation. 1 + -1 + 4u =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0 0 + 4u = 0 + -1 4u =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 0 + -1 = -1 4u = -1 Divide each side by '4'. u = -0.25 Simplifying u = -0.25

Solution

u = {-4, -0.25}
